Comprehending Parrot Species
Parrots can be found in different types, each with unique qualities. The most typically kept pet parrots include:
Budgerigar (Budgie)African GreyAmazon ParrotCockatooMacawTable 1: Comparison of Common Parrot SpeciesParrot SpeciesAverage LifespanSize (inches)Cost (GBP)Social NeedsNoise LevelTrainabilityBudgerigar5-10 years7-8₤ 15-₤ 100ModerateLowHighAfrican Grey40-60 years12-14₤ 800-₤ 3,000HighModerateVery HighAmazon Parrot25-50 years10-15₤ 400-₤ 2,000HighHighHighCockatoo40-60 years12-24₤ 1,000-₤ 3,500Extremely HighReally HighHighMacaw30-50 years20-40₤ 1,500-₤ 3,500Extremely HighReally HighModerateFactors to Consider When Buying a Parrot

What should I try to find in a reputable breeder?
Pick a breeder with an excellent reputation who is transparent about health records, breeding practices, and provides a comfy environment for the birds.
2. How do I know if a parrot is healthy?
Observe the bird's feathers (they must be smooth and clean), eyes (intense and clear), and beak (smooth without cracks). A healthy parrot is likewise active and alert.
3. Just how much time do parrots need daily?
A lot of parrots need several hours of social interaction every day, together with time to exercise outside their cages.
4. Are parrots suitable for novice family pet owners?
It depends on the types. Smaller parrots like budgies are frequently much better for beginners than bigger types like cockatoos or Graupapagei Zu Verkaufen macaws.
5. What type of diet plan do parrots need?
A well-balanced diet plan consists of top quality pellets, fresh fruits, veggies, seeds, and nuts. Some species have specific dietary requirements.
